There is nothing wrong with competition. Especially when we have only 6% global market penetration this year, growing to 6.5% next year, with the global TAM at US $ 7.7 B this year and growing to US $8.4 B next year.
As Leigh Jasper put, the biggest competition is really contractors using their own in house systems or spreadsheets- that's still 94% of the TAM!
So any competition is good if it helps to raise awareness. Bring it on. No issue if Procore eventually do open an office in Australia- just don't think they will make it anytime soon. Happy to be proven wrong.
